Fred Hamer collection, CD 61

Material type: MusicMusicPublisher number: BLSA C 433 41 Side 2 | British Library Sound ArchivePublication details: British Library Sound Archive, 1950-1969.Description: 1 sound disc : digital ; 4 3/4 inAvailable additional physical forms:
  • BLSA archive CDR: 1CDR0003561; BL Archive tape: H1870; Hamer tape No: 5/17 Side 2.
Contents:
Side 2: 1. [announcement] C443/41 Side 2: -- 2. Harry Scott, Eaton Bray, Bedfordshire (recorded by David Shaw): 00:00 Here's luck to an English soldier [Roud 23605, recited] -- 01:43 No more I wish to roam [recitation] -- 03:58 [conversation] -- 04:52 Some people always look ahead [Roud 23606, recited] -- 05:33 As you ask for a toast now a toast I will give [Roud 23607, recited, interrupted by next item] -- 05:46 [fragment of interview about farming] -- Harry Scott, Eaton Bray, Bedfordshire: 06:18 Give my love to Nancy [Roud 13676] -- 07:43 I once knew a widow [Roud 23919, fragment] -- 08:21 Miller of the Dee [Roud 503, recited] -- 09:40 Little golden ring [Roud 23608, fragment] -- 10:31 The ploughboy's voice [Rod 9688] -- 11:58 Seeds of love [Roud 3] -- 14:45 the oak and the ash [Roud 269, fragment] -- 16:27 Come listen to me [Roud 23595] -- 19:52 Woodman spare that tree [Roud 13833, recited] -- 21:21 Queen of the May [Roud 594, recited] -- 24:10 The sailor and the soldier [Roud 350] -- 26:35 We're all jolly fellows that follow the plough [Roud 346, recited] -- 28:35 Some folks they get grey haired [Roud 23840] -- 29:18 One more glass before we're parting [Roud 23599] -- 29:50 Little brown jug [Roud 725, fragment] -- 31:53 Many a time [Roud 23918, fragment] -- 32:20 I live in Trafalgar Square [fragment, cut off] -- Mrs White, Cranfield, Bedfordshire -- 32:38 Interview about lace tells -- 33:09 One pin I done today (lace tell) [Roud 1144] -- 33:45 I saw them that never saw me (lace tell) [Roud 1144] -- 3. Tim Hart & Maddy Prior: 00:00 May song [Roud 305] -- 02:00 Captain Galligan [Roud 920].
